| LC_A = 5.555556 |
| LC_B = 0.052272 |
| LC_C = 0.247190 |
| LC_D = 0.385537 |
| LC_E = 5.367655 |
| LC_F = 0.092809 |
| LC_CUT = 0.010591 |
| LC_CUT_LOG = LC_E * LC_CUT + LC_F |
|
|
| def _logc3_decompress(logc: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or: |
| logc = logc.clamp(0.0, 1.0) |
| lin_from_log = (10.0 ** ((logc - LC_D) / LC_C) - LC_B) / LC_A |
| lin_from_lin = (logc - LC_F) / LC_E |
| return torch.where(logc >= LC_CUT_LOG, lin_from_log, lin_from_lin) |
|
|
|
|
| def _linear_to_srgb(x: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or: |
| cutoff = 0.0031308 |
| return torch.where( |
| x <= cutoff, |
| 12.92 * x, |
| 1.055 * torch.pow(x.clamp(min=cutoff), 1.0 / 2.4) - 0.055, |
| ).clamp_(0.0, 1.0) |
|
|
|
|
| def _srgb_to_linear(x: torch.Tensor) -> torch.Tensor: |
| cutoff = 0.04045 |
| return torch.where( |
| x <= cutoff, |
| x / 12.92, |
| ((x.clamp(min=0.0) + 0.055) / 1.055) ** 2.4, |
| ) |
